Since getting my medical card and having access to a wide variety of strains, I've found that the best effects (for me) come from strains with a CBD:THC ratio in the 1:2 to 2:1 range.

It would be nice to grow my own with that sort of CBD:THC ratio. From what I've read, though, it seems like there are some strains available with reliably high CBD/very low THC, but the strains with a ratio closer to 1:1 can have a wide range of phenotypes/cannabinoid ratios.

I don't have access to known clones or testing labs at the moment, so are there strains out there that do produce a reliable/consistent ratio from seed?

I'd say there is actually a good amount of stability in many breeders highcbd / lowthc seeds today.
Generally any breeder/project with involvement from the CBD Crew should hit the mark.

These have been great
  • 00 Seeds - Chocolate Skunk CBD (~1:1 amazing aroma, terps, resin, yield.. new fav maybe)
  • 00 Seeds - White Widow CBD (higher cbd production, 2:1, 3:1, not as exotic terps in some phenos, good yield.)
  • Barneys Farm - Critical Cure CBD (~1.5:1 good terps and effects. fruity, spicy, pine, average yield)
  • HSO - Green Crack CBD (very strong mango terps, short branched plant. ~2:1, large yield)
  • Dinafem - CBD Plus (25:1 or so, citrus terps and great resin production, takes weeks longer to dry. this strain's effects won't satisfy most people, but its nice to mix-in or use for oil)
  • Expert Seeds - Clinical White CBD (This one claims 2:1, but felt strong like many thc strains, sativa. Still a great strain, but just beware)

Also currently checking out Harlequin Fast, Dutch Passion - CBD Kush, and more many more mixed CBD Crew.

My recommendation is to start with 1:1 or 2:1. The 00 Seeds are very cheap ($25 ish) and could be a good start. Critical Cure is also a major CBD go-to.
If having trouble finding seeds, then lower thc strains like Flo are also an option I'd recommend.

So yeah the clone-only, tested CBD strains are a good solution if available, but not sure I'll go back after seeing some of what the recent CBD fem seeds can do. No need =D
